snarble… Are running 32 Bit or 64 Bit system? Go here http://reshade.me/sweetfx and grab this, scroll down to bottom of page Reshade 2.0.3 SweetFX 2.0. There’s an application inside after you extract it called Reshade SetUp. It’s basically the same as when you install BMS…you must show it where to go. It will ask you to Select Game. Show it to your FalconBMS folder DO NOT SEND IT TO LAUNCHER.exe in Root Folder!!! If your running a 32 Bit system…show it to C\FalconBMS\Bin\X86 folder and click on the 32 Bit exe, or if your running 64 Bit go to C\FalconBMS\Bin\x64 and click the 64 Bit Falcon BMS exe. After you click either of them depending on 32 Bit or 64 Bit…the program will automatically detect the exe and install SweetFX for you. You will see in the box the directx 9 option light up or if it stay’s blank, click on Directx 9 option… Then the box will say Run game or Launch Game i forget…After you launch game you should see alot of text in top Left corner of your screen…If you see that, your good to go!!! If its working, then go to what ever folder you installed too, X86 or x64, Sweetfx folder\Settings and start changing your colors or whatever you wanna do.
